TinyLogic UHS Inverter with Schmitt Trigger Input # Introduction to the NC7SZ14M5X  

The **NC7SZ14M5X** is a high-performance, single-gate Schmitt-trigger inverter integrated circuit (IC) designed for low-voltage applications. Manufactured using advanced CMOS technology, this component is part of the **TinyLogic®** family, known for its compact size and efficient power consumption.  

Featuring a Schmitt-trigger input, the NC7SZ14M5X provides hysteresis, making it highly resistant to noise and signal bounce. This characteristic ensures stable output transitions even with slow or fluctuating input signals, making it ideal for signal conditioning and waveform shaping in digital circuits.  

The device operates within a **1.65V to 5.5V** supply range, making it versatile for both battery-powered and standard logic-level applications. Its **SC-70-5 (SOT-353)** package offers a space-saving footprint, suitable for high-density PCB designs.  

Key features include:  
- **Single Schmitt-trigger inverter**  
- **Wide operating voltage range**  
- **Low power consumption**  
- **Fast propagation delay**  

Common applications include signal buffering, noise filtering, and interfacing between different logic levels in portable electronics, IoT devices, and embedded systems. The NC7SZ14M5X combines reliability with compact design, making it a practical choice for modern electronic designs.
